How to get rid of perspective tool illustrator?

Go to View > Perspective Grid > Hide Grid to get rid of the perspective grid or View > Perspective Grid > Show Grid to turn back on the perspective grid. Alternatively, you can use the Shift-Control-I keyboard shortcut to quickly get rid of the perspective grid in Illustrator.

Frequent question, how do I reset the Perspective Grid tool in Illustrator? 1 Correct answer You can reset the grid back to its default by going to View menu > Perspective Grid > Two Point Perspective > [2P-Normal View]. You can hide the grid by hitting Shift-Ctrl-I or clicking on the small ‘x’ in the Plane Switching widget (present at the top left of the document window when grid is visible).

Considering this, how do I turn on perspective in Illustrator? Open the Perspective Grid tool Hit the Perspective Grid tool from the tools panel or press shift+P. A default two-point perspective grid and a plane switching widget will pop up in your document. You can use the widget to select the active grid plane.The shortcut for toggling in and out of 3D mode is command+shift+i (ctrl+shift+i if on a PC). Hope this helped!

How do I turn off mesh in Illustrator?

  1. Select the object that is gradient meshed by clicking on it with your mouse.
  2. Select “Object” followed by “Path” and “Offset Path.”
  3. Enter “0” in the “Offset” box, and then select “OK.” Your meshed object will revert back to a path object.

How do you move the perspective grid in Illustrator?

To do this, select your perspective grid tool, and hover over the ground plane widget on either the left or right side of the ground plane. You’ll notice that your cursor turns into a directional arrow. You can then grab and reposition this wherever you need it to go on your artboards.

What is the perspective Selection tool in Illustrator?

The Perspective Selection tool – Illustrator Tutorial This tool allows me to edit my Grid Planes and also edit the objects located on those Planes. To get to the Perspective Selection Tool, simply click and hold down on the Perspective Grid Tool and select the Perspective Selection Tool.

How do you delete mesh points?

Select the Mesh tool, if it’s not already selected, and position the pointer over the center mesh point. Hold down the Alt (Windows) or Option (Mac) key. A minus sign (-) appears next to the pointer. Click the point to remove that point and its associated mesh lines.

How do I get rid of transparency grid in Photoshop?

To remove the Photoshop transparency grid, open the Grid Size dropdown. You can make the grid smaller or larger from this dropdown and you can remove it completely. Select the ‘None’ option and the grid will be removed.
